How can individuals cultivate a sense of self-awareness to effectively navigate high-pressure situations, leveraging both their intuition and rational decision-making skills to achieve optimal outcomes?
Individuals can cultivate self-awareness by regularly reflecting on their thoughts, emotions, and behaviors, as well as seeking feedback from others. This can help them understand their strengths, weaknesses, and values, enabling them to make more informed decisions in high-pressure situations. By honing their intuition through practice and mindfulness, individuals can tap into their subconscious knowledge and gut feelings to guide their decision-making. Combining intuition with rational decision-making skills, such as analyzing data and weighing pros and cons, can help individuals make more balanced and effective choices in high-pressure situations, leading to optimal outcomes.
